Organisations will be able to use a new online tool in the new year to help them determine if their premises or event falls within the scope of Martyn's Law. The Security Industry Authority (SIA) is developing this tool and is seeking volunteers to help test it.
For those already aware that Martyn's Law applies to them, the SIA is creating templates to assist with compliance. These templates are designed to help document procedures and measures for both standard and enhanced tiers, though their use is not mandatory.
The SIA has also conducted pilot assessments and inspections, with a second round planned for this autumn. This work aims to refine tools and understand potential challenges organisations may face in complying with the new law.
A notification portal, accessible via GOV.UK, is also under development to simplify the process for organisations of all sizes. Volunteers are still needed to help test this system in the coming months.
